Migrants deported to South Sudan must stay in U.S. custody and not be released. An emergency hearing is set for today after a federal judge says the deportation of dozens of migrants from countries like Vietnam and Myanmar to the African country where they're not from may violate a court order, saying the Trump administration may be in contempt for disobeying the order.
